This comprehensive and up-to-date resource focuses on correcting malocclusions using the MBT™ philosophy, widely accepted as one of the most reliable and effective treatment methods in orthodontics. Extensively illustrated with line diagrams and color photographs, it describes mainstream thinking and serves as a practical manual of clinical orthodontics.

  • Clear coverage of each stage of treatment - anchorage control during tooth leveling and aligning, arch leveling and overbite control, space closure and finishing
  • Covers recent changes to the appliance system, bracket placement and archwire technology
  • Written by three internationally recognised experts who lecture on the technique throughout the world
  • Discusses both extraction and non-extraction treatments
  • Lavishly illustrated throughout with colour photographs, line diagrams and radiographs
